Unwanted blocks when adding articles
« on: January 12, 2012, 04:14:04 PM »
I recently decided to add a few articles to the portal...however, when I select the topic I want to add as an article...the navigation and donation blocks I created appear on the page to select the category for the article.  These are the only two blocks that appear there.

Does anyone know why this is happening?

I used advanced settings for these two blocks and they should only appear on the portal page.  Yet, when I want to add an article...they appear.

Re: Unwanted blocks when adding articles
« Reply #5 on: January 26, 2012, 11:08:40 AM »
I have seen this problem many a time.

And here is why.

Try this: http://xxxxxxxx.xxx/index.php?action=portal

That's your portal. Your advances settings specifically say they are allowed to show up for the portal page.
So Simple Portal is doing exactly what you told it to do.

Only that's not what you want.
This is a funny little feature.  Perhaps one would even call it a bug.  In fact, I have reported it as a bug just now.
http://simpleportal.net/index.php?issue=455.0

Here's how to work around it.
If you have used Advanced Options to show a block on the portal, and are now troubled because that block is showing up on the Add Article page, simply type the following into the Custom Display Options box: -~sa|addarticle

That will take care of the addarticle subaction. If the block pops up at any other inappropriate moments, you can handle it with a similar custom display option.

Re: Unwanted blocks when adding articles
« Reply #11 on: March 03, 2012, 02:38:18 AM »
You can add as much as you want separating them by commas. Like:

Code: [Select]
~sa|articles,~page|new,projects,-market

Re: Unwanted blocks when adding articles
« Reply #12 on: March 03, 2012, 03:31:24 AM »
Thank you, [SiNaN]...That'll do it....but, I still don't get it.

I have a mod (action=kb) that I want a certain block to appear on.  So, in this field I type ~action|kb and the block appears on all kb pages.  However, if I don't want it to appear on this page (xxxx://glitchpc.net/index.php?action=kb;area=addknow;cat=0) how would that be coded?

Re: Unwanted blocks when adding articles
« Reply #13 on: March 06, 2012, 03:57:13 PM »
You can try

~action|kb,-~cat|0

Or you could try

~action|kb,-~area|addknow

I'm not sure which one is correct for you, since I am not familiar with "kb".
